THE MICHAEL ANDRETTI FOUNDATION, BEAM GLOBAL SPIRITS & WINE, INC. AND CANADIAN CLUBŪ JOIN LOCAL ORGANIZATIONS TO FIGHT UNDERAGE DRINKING IN MICHIGAN

65% of Teens Get Alcohol from Family and Friends

WHAT

The Michael Andretti Foundation, Beam Global Spirits & Wine, Inc. and Canadian ClubŪ will launch a campaign designed to encourage parents to talk with their teens about the dangers of underage drinking.

The goal of the initiative is to raise awareness among parents about how their teens get the alcohol they drink and emphasize the importance of talking to their teens about the dangers of underage drinking. The key components to the campaign are a 30 second TV PSA, buttons and informational cards for parents to be distributed at the point of purchase.

WHY

A recent survey commissioned by The Century Council, a national not-for-profit organization funded by the nation's leading distillers to fight drunk driving and underage drinking, revealed that 65% of underage youth who drink obtain alcohol from family and friends, with or without permission.  The survey also shows 7% of youth report that they obtained alcohol from retailers who failed to check for identification. According to the 2004 National Survey on Drug Use and Health (SAMHSA), over 30% of 12-20 year olds reported past month alcohol consumption in Michigan.

In Michigan, 812 youths under the age of 18 were arrested for driving under the influence, 5,071 youths were arrested for liquor law violations, and 16 youths were arrested for drunkenness last year (UCR 2004).
